Abstract: Category theory can be applied to mathematically model the semantics of cognitive neural systems. Here, we employ colimits, functors and natural transformations to model the implementation of concept hierarchies in neural networks equipped with multiple sensors. 1 Introduction In this paper, we describe a mathematical scheme for the analysis and design of cognitive neural network architectures based upon functors and natural transformations, the structural mappings of category theory.
